Choosing the Right Venue

San Diego offers a plethora of stunning venues that cater to a variety of corporate events. Whether you're planning a conference, a team-building retreat, or a product launch, the first step is to select a venue that aligns with your event's purpose and size. Consider options like waterfront hotels, urban event spaces, or outdoor gardens. Each venue type provides a unique ambiance that can enhance your event's theme.

Accessibility and Amenities

Accessibility is crucial when selecting a venue. Ensure the location is convenient for your guests and provides ample parking or easy access to public transportation. Additionally, check for essential amenities such as Wi-Fi, audiovisual equipment, and on-site catering options. These features can significantly impact the overall experience for your attendees.

Creating an Engaging Agenda

Developing a compelling agenda is key to keeping attendees engaged throughout your event. Start by identifying your event's goals and tailor the sessions to meet those objectives. Incorporate a mix of keynote speeches, breakout sessions, and interactive workshops to appeal to different interests and learning styles.

Incorporating Local Culture

Take advantage of San Diego's vibrant culture by including local elements in your agenda. Consider inviting local speakers, featuring regional cuisine, or organizing activities that showcase the city's unique attractions. This approach not only enriches the event experience but also supports the local community.

Effective Promotion Strategies

Promoting your corporate event effectively is essential to ensure a successful turnout. Utilize digital marketing channels such as social media, email campaigns, and event listing websites to reach your target audience. Highlight key speakers, unique activities, and any special offers to generate excitement and encourage registration.

Engaging with Attendees Pre-Event

Engage with your audience before the event by creating interactive content like polls, Q&A sessions, or behind-the-scenes sneak peeks. This engagement helps build anticipation and allows you to gather insights into what your attendees are most interested in, enabling you to tailor the event more closely to their preferences.

Ensuring a Seamless Day-of Experience

On the day of the event, attention to detail is paramount. Ensure that your team is well-prepared to handle everything from registration to troubleshooting technical issues. Having a clear timeline and assigning specific roles can help the event run smoothly, leaving your guests with a positive impression.

Gathering Feedback and Following Up

Post-event, gathering feedback is invaluable. Use surveys or feedback forms to capture attendee experiences and insights. This information will not only help you assess the success of your event but also guide improvements for future endeavors. Follow up with a thank-you email, including highlights from the event and information on upcoming activities.
